Today is the 81st anniversary of the atomic bombing of Hiroshima. For @thebulletin.org, I wrote a short piece on the curious story of the "Hiroshima Maidens," and what it tells us about the complicated politics of memory. thebulletin.org/2026/08/the-...
The political implications of Hiroshima’s scarred “maidens”
In May 1955, 25 young Japanese women, all of whom had been schoolchildren who survived the atomic bombing of Hiroshima, were flown to the United States. They became known in the press as the “Hiroshim...
